New study aims to stop Kids' lungs from collapsing during surgery
Disease control Not yet recruitingThis study aims to find the best way to protect children's lungs during surgery. It will test three different breathing support methods given by the ventilator to see which one best prevents lung collapse and reduces strain on the lungs. Could a sip before surgery calm Kids' nerves? new study tests fasting rules
Symptom relief Not yet recruitingThis study aims to find the best way for children to fast before surgery. Researchers will compare three different rules about when kids must stop drinking clear liquids before an operation.
